| Latest offers in control and IT International Dyer, May 2004 Page 11 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- <<prev 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 Orintex System Uses Barcodes Monitor-Pro is the software developed by Orintex of Italy to allow the control and monitoring of production processes, in real time. It enables a precise management overview of the production equipment and resources by sending information on all phases of the production process as it occurs. This includes machine capacity; duration of each process; delay information compared to standard procedure; operator details; downtime for maintenance or temporary stoppages - all steps in the process of calculating true production costs. A barcode reading system relays information to the central information point from the operator and machine thus allowing the status of all production processes to be followed through each working phase. Quality control can be monitored and managed via Monitor-Pro. Invoicing can also be carried out using data from the system. The system can also be used to keep customers informed about the progress of their job via the Internet. Bonfiglioli active' Inverters Italian company Bonfiglioli (maker of drive equipment for the transport and industrial automation industries) acquired the German manufacturer of inverters, Vectron Elektronik, two years ago. The acquisition has led the company to develop products for 'mechatronic' solutions to customers' automation requirements. It has recently brought to market a new inverter range called 'Active', which it says provides robust control function; is suitable for use in very hot environments; and has speed control with a resolution of 1 millionth of a Hz.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- <<prev 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 |
